Sean Connery’s Wife Reveals Where the Family Will Spread His Ashes

Actor Sean Connery’s family, honoring his final wish, will scatter his ashes in two of his favorite locations.

The 90-year-old James Bond actor died on October 31 at his home in the Bahamas.

Now, according to People, his widow Micheline Roquebrune tells The Scottish Mail on Sunday, “We are going to bring Sean back to Scotland — that was his final wish… He wanted his ashes to be scattered in the Bahamas and also in his homeland.”

Micheline, who was married to the star for 45 years, explained that they will go “whenever it is possible and safe to travel again. Then it is the family’s intention to return to Scotland with him.”

“We would like to organize a memorial service for him in Scotland — that is our hope,” she said. “But we cannot say when this will happen exactly.”

Previously, Connery’s son Jason told the BBC that his dad had died in his sleep in the Bahamas, but that many of those closest to him were able to be by his side. He also confirmed his father had been in poor health, noting, “We are all working at understanding this huge event as it only happened so recently, even though my dad has been unwell for some time. A sad day for all who knew and loved my dad and a sad loss for all people around the world who enjoyed the wonderful gift he had as an actor.”

In an earlier statement, the actor’s publicist, Nancy Seltzer, confirmed there would be a small service, and that a larger memorial would be planned post-pandemic.
